Поделиться через


Метод Project.ExportAsFixedFormat (Project)

Экспортирует активный проект в виде документа в пользовательском формате PDF или XPS.

Синтаксис

expression. ExportAsFixedFormat (FileName, FileType, IncludeDocumentProperties, IncludeDocumentMarkup, ArchiveFormat, FromDate, ToDate, FixedFormatExtClassPtr)

Выражение Выражение, возвращающее объект Project .

Параметры

Имя Обязательный или необязательный Тип данных Описание
FileName Обязательный String Указывает имя файла экспортированного документа. Значение по умолчанию — это имя активного проекта в виде PDF-файла.
FileType Необязательный PjDocExportType Указывает, следует ли экспортировать проект в виде документа PDF или XPS. Значение по умолчанию — pjPDF (0).
IncludeDocumentProperties Необязательный Логический Если задано значение True, последняя страница экспортированного документа содержит некоторые свойства документа. Значение по умолчанию — True.
IncludeDocumentMarkup Необязательный Логический Если значение true, последняя страница экспортированного документа содержит условные обозначения символов, отображаемых в представлении. Значение по умолчанию — True.
ArchiveFormat Необязательный Логический Если задано значение True, экспортирует pdf-документ в формате, совместимом с ISO 19500-1 (PDF/A). Значение по умолчанию — False.
FromDate Необязательный Variant Дата начала диапазона дат для публикации. Значение по умолчанию — дата начала проекта.
ToDate Необязательный Variant Дата окончания диапазона дат для публикации. Значение по умолчанию — дата окончания проекта.
FixedFormatExtClassPtr Необязательный Variant Указатель на пользовательский класс в надстройке, реализующий COM-интерфейс IMsoDocExporter , который позволяет вызывать альтернативную реализацию кода для формата документа. По умолчанию используется пустой указатель.

Возвращаемое значение

Nothing

Замечания

Метод ExportAsFixedFormat аналогичен методу DocumentExport , но параметр FileName является обязательным, а необязательный параметр FixedFormatExtClassPtr является указателем на пользовательский класс, который создает пользовательский формат PDF или XPS.

Пример

Если в активном проекте отображается представление сетевой схемы, в следующем примере создается документ XPS с именем TestProject.xps. При открытии файла в приложении средства просмотра XPS на последней странице содержатся свойства документа и условные обозначения с символами диаграммы PERT.

ExportAsFixedFormat FileName:="TestProject.xps", FileType:=pjXPS

Поддержка и обратная связь

Есть вопросы или отзывы, касающиеся Office VBA или этой статьи? Руководство по другим способам получения поддержки и отправки отзывов см. в статье Поддержка Office VBA и обратная связь.